        Pearl 6: 
Remember Who You Are 
   and Whose You Are


Original Text:  A good friend of mine was always told this by his father before he walked out the door each day. I think it annoyed him at the time. Rather, I know it did.  But, I can imagine that he now appreciates the sentiment. It was a loving and fatherly reminder to honor and live the life that God would want of him.  From a Christian perspective it was, and is, a reminder that through Christ we are given this incredibly precious gift called "life". 

I'm not willing to believe that my existence on this earth is by accident or without purpose. I'm not willing to believe that of yours, either. I believe in God...and God doesn't make mistakes.    - PCD
